WebBooting the USB: You should now be ready to boot Solus. To boot Solus, shut down your computer and plug in your USB that has Solus on it. Turn your computer back on, but hold the left alt key while you do it. You should see a menu with two options, something like macOS and USB. Use the arrow keys to choose the one for the usb and and press enter. WebFeb 2, 2024 · Connect a USB drive or insert a DVD into your computer.
